What Are Robot Hoovers?

Robot hoovers, also understood as robotic vacuums or robot vacuum, are intelligent cleaning gadgets that are designed to autonomously tidy floors. These gadgets utilize a combination of sensing units, mapping technology, and algorithms to browse around barriers, avoid stairs, and cover as much of the floor location as possible. They can be arranged to clean up at specific times, and lots of models can even go back to their charging docks when their batteries are low.

The Evolution of Robot Hoovers

The idea of a robot hoover is not brand-new. The very first business robot vacuum, the Electrolux Trilobite, was presented in 2001. However, it was the iRobot Roomba, introduced in 2002, that genuinely popularized the innovation. Throughout the years, robot hoovers have gone through substantial advancements. Modern designs are more sophisticated, with features such as:

  • Improved Navigation: Advanced sensing units and SLAM (Simultaneous Localization and Mapping) innovation enable robot hoovers to produce comprehensive maps of the home and navigate effectively.
  • Boosted Cleaning Power: Higher suction power and multi-surface cleaning abilities make them effective on numerous floor types, consisting of carpets, wood, and tiles.
  • Smart Integration: Many robot hoovers can be controlled by means of smart device apps, voice assistants, and even incorporated with smart home systems.
  • Dust Collection Systems: Improved dust collection and larger bins decrease the frequency of emptying.
  • Challenge Avoidance: Enhanced sensing units and AI guarantee that robot hoovers can avoid furnishings, family pets, and other challenges without getting stuck.

How Robot Hoovers Work

Mapping and Navigation:

  • Initial Setup: When first introduced to a new environment, the robot hoover utilizes its sensing units to develop a map of the home. This process typically includes a trial run where the robot walks around the house, collecting information about the layout.
  • Course Planning: Once the map is created, the robot uses algorithms to prepare the most efficient cleaning course. It prevents challenges and makes sure that it covers all locations of the home.
  • Real-Time Adjustments: As the robot hoover cleans up, it constantly updates its map to reflect any changes in the environment, such as moved furnishings or brand-new obstacles.

Cleaning Modes:

  • Spot Cleaning: For focused cleaning in particular areas, such as a spill or a particularly unclean area.
  • Edge Cleaning: Some models have a dedicated edge-cleaning mode to guarantee that areas along the walls and under furniture are thoroughly cleaned up.
  • Scheduling: Users can set the robot hoover to clean up at particular times, ensuring that the home is constantly clean.

Maintenance:

  • Filter Cleaning: Regular cleaning of the filter is vital to maintain the robot hoover's performance.
  • Brush and Mop Replacement: Over time, the brushes and mops may break and need replacement.
  • Software application Updates: Many contemporary robot hoovers get regular software application updates to enhance their functionality and efficiency.

Typical FAQs About Robot Hoovers

Q1: Are robot hoovers as efficient as traditional vacuum cleaners?

  • While robot hoovers may not have the exact same raw cleaning power as standard vacuum cleaners, they are developed to clean more regularly and consistently. For daily maintenance, they are extremely reliable and can manage most family cleaning needs.

Q2: Can robot hoovers browse stairs and other barriers?

  • Many robot hoovers are geared up with cliff sensors to avoid them from falling down stairs. They can browse around furniture and other obstacles, however it's best to keep the floor relatively clear to guarantee optimum efficiency.

Q3: How frequently do I require to empty the dust bin?

  • The frequency of clearing the dust bin depends on the size of the home and the quantity of debris. Usually, a larger dust bin will require to be emptied less often. For the majority of users, emptying the bin when a week is enough.

Q4: Can robot hoovers be utilized in homes with pets?

  • Yes, many robot hoovers are particularly created to handle pet hair and dander. They can clean under furnishings and in hard-to-reach areas where pet hair typically accumulates.

Q5: Are robot hoovers noisy?

  • Many robot hoovers are developed to be reasonably peaceful, however the noise level can vary. Search for models with noise scores listed below 60 decibels for a more enjoyable cleaning experience.

Q6: Can I control a robot hoover remotely?

  • Yes, lots of modern robot hoovers can be managed via a smart device app or voice assistant. This allows users to begin, stop, and schedule cleaning sessions from anywhere.
